INCHARGE Posted September 26, 2015 #55 Share Posted September 26, 2015 (edited) What is the room below your signature - what ship and room category - it looks awesome! Hi. This is a 6K Grand Ocean View Cabin, which cost less than a balcony, and is huge. This one was on the Valor. There are only 2, and they are on Lido. Sunshine, Conquest, Glory, and one other ship has them. Edited September 26, 2015 by INCHARGE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
